Skip to content

Commit 5053583

Browse files
refactor: mark unexported public API using @public
1 parent a3240a4 commit 5053583

File tree

2 files changed

+7
-0
lines changed

2 files changed

+7
-0
lines changed

Project.toml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-27,6 +27,7 @@ RecursiveArrayTools = "731186ca-8d62-57ce-b412-fbd966d074cd"
2727
Reexport = "189a3867-3050-52da-a836-e630ba90ab69"
2828
RuntimeGeneratedFunctions = "7e49a35a-f44a-4d26-94aa-eba1b4ca6b47"
2929
SciMLOperators = "c0aeaf25-5076-4817-a8d5-81caf7dfa961"
30+
SciMLPublic = "431bcebd-1456-4ced-9d72-93c2757fff0b"
3031
SciMLStructures = "53ae85a6-f571-4167-b2af-e1d143709226"
3132
StaticArraysCore = "1e83bf80-4336-4d27-bf5d-d5a4f845583c"
3233
Statistics = "10745b16-79ce-11e8-11f9-7d13ad32a3b2"
@@ -86,6 +87,7 @@ RecursiveArrayTools = "3.27.2"
8687
Reexport = "1"
8788
RuntimeGeneratedFunctions = "0.5.12"
8889
SciMLOperators = "1.3"
90+
SciMLPublic = "1.0.0"
8991
SciMLStructures = "1.1"
9092
StableRNGs = "1.0"
9193
StaticArrays = "1.7"

src/SciMLBase.jl

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-44,6 +44,8 @@ import SciMLOperators:
4444

4545
@reexport using SciMLOperators
4646

47+
import SciMLPublic: @public
48+
4749
function __solve end
4850
function __init end
4951

@@ -866,4 +868,7 @@ export Clocks, TimeDomain, is_discrete_time_domain, isclock, issolverstepclock,
866868

867869
export ODEAliasSpecifier, LinearAliasSpecifier
868870

871+
@public SymbolicLinearInterface, get_new_A_b, create_parameter_timeseries_collection,
872+
get_saveable_values, save_discretes!
873+
869874
end

0 commit comments

Comments
 (0)